免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app界面ui设计开发原则

在移动应用程序中,用户界面(User Interface,简称UI)设计应该是一个重点关注的方面。UI设计的目标是设计出用户友好的应用程序界面。一个好的UI设计应该具有兼容性、可访问性、可靠性、易用性、效率和可维护性等方面的特点。下面是一些UI设计开发原则。

1. 简洁明了

一个好的UI设计应该尽可能简化用户发现和完成任务的方式,以减少用户在使用应用程序时的思维负担。UI设计师应该尝试保持界面的简洁和简单,不要通过过多的复杂元素来拖慢应用程序的加载时间,并将主要内容和功能放在容易被用户看到和访问的地方。

2. 一致性

UI设计师应该保持设计的一致性,以便于用户快速学习和使用应用程序。一致性包括颜色、字体、图标和布局等方面。保持一致性可以使用户专注于他们正在处理的任务,而不是界面本身。

3. 可操作性

UI设计需要明确显示用户交互方式,这样用户才能很容易地开始使用并掌握应用程序。UI设计师应该尽可能保持应用程序具有可用的控件和工具来进行各种操作。例如,按钮应该有明确的标签和醒目的颜色,下拉菜单应该具有清晰的列表和有效的搜索。

4. 易理解

UI设计师应该通过使用通用和易于理解的图标、符号和字体,提供给用户清晰、简单的语言和流畅的语境等方式,使用户可以在不费力的前提下理解应用程序中的内容,操作方式以及可用的功能。

5. 可扩展性

UI设计师应该考虑到用户需要随时进行的操作,以及未来可能需要的新功能和操作。设计需要具有可扩展性,这样用户才能轻松地在不同的情况下进行不同的任务。因此,UI设计师应该预留足够的空间和灵活的结构,以便未来增加新的功能时不需要重构整个UI。

6. 反馈机制

UI设计师应该确保应用程序给出及时和精确的反馈,以帮助用户理解应用程序中的操作和反应。例如,可以通过使用动画和声音等方式确认用户的操作,并给出反馈以指示操作是否成功或失败。

7. 可访问性

UI设计师应该确保所有人都可以使用应用程序,包括残障人士。设计应该遵循可访问性相关的最佳实践,例如选择高对比度的颜色、使用大字体和易于理解的语言等。

总之,UI设计是一门复杂的学问,需要UI设计师在设计过程中注重用户的体验,充分考虑用户的需求,提供合适的功能和操作,以及保持一致性,简单明了。这些开发原则可以帮助UI设计师构建出一款用户友好、易于用和高效的应用程序界面。


相关知识:
如何开发一款app作为安卓的桌面
开发一款作为安卓桌面的应用程序需要了解以下几个方面的知识:1. 安卓桌面的基本组成2. 安卓应用程序开发3. 安卓应用程序与桌面的交互1. 安卓桌面的基本组成安卓桌面是由桌面和小部件构成的。桌面通常由应用程序图标和文件夹组成,而小部件则是一个功能特定的应用
2024-01-10
如何开发一个不需要后台的app
在移动应用开发中,后台通常指的是服务器端,主要用于存储数据、处理业务逻辑等。但是有些应用并不需要服务器端的支持,也可以在本地实现功能,这就是不需要后台的应用。本文将介绍不需要后台的应用开发的原理和方法。一、原理不需要后台的应用,一般是指只需要在本地运行的应
2024-01-10
任务发布app小程序开发
随着互联网的不断发展,越来越多的人开始使用任务发布app小程序,这种小程序具有轻便、易用、功能丰富等优点,受到了用户们的欢迎。那么,任务发布app小程序的开发原理是什么呢?下面我们就来详细介绍一下。一、什么是小程序?小程序是一种轻量级的应用程序,它可以在微
2024-01-10
app能发布开发人员版本吗
当开发人员完成一个应用程序的开发后,他们通常会将其发布为一个可执行的文件,以供用户使用。但是,在发布给最终用户之前,开发人员通常会发布一个专门供其他开发人员使用的版本,以便进行测试、调试和协作。这个版本通常被称为开发人员版本或开发者版。开发人员版本的发布通
2023-06-29
app开发对商业模式的影响
随着移动互联网的发展,APP正在成为商业模式的重要一环。APP在商业模式中的作用不仅仅是提供一个新的销售渠道,而是具有更为深远的影响。本文将详细介绍APP开发对商业模式的影响。一、互联网商业模式的演变在互联网出现之前,传统的商业模式主要依靠线下渠道销售。随
2023-06-29
app开发好点子
移动应用程序开发已成为广受欢迎的行业,每天都会涌现出大量的创意和好点子。随着技术的不断发展和创新,新的应用程序正在不断涌现。 如果你正在寻找一个好点子,建议您考虑以下几个方面:1. 常见问题的解决我们的生活中存在很多常见问题,如获取医疗咨询、保持健康生活、
2023-06-29